WebHow can I get a federal concealed carry permit? There is no such thing right now, but the federal government is supposed to be working on requiring states to extend “full faith and credit” to carry licenses from other states sometime soon. WebAn approved concealed weapon license is valid for a five-year period. The fee is $40 and is non-refundable. This amount includes the application fee of $30 and the background check fee of $10.
